Job Overview:

Transform patient care through AI and technology as an Associate Clinical Consultant at our cutting-edge EMR and AI healthcare solutions company, where innovation meets clinical expertise. Dive into a dynamic role that blends evidence-based content development, workflow optimization, and collaborative problem-solving—with the added opportunity to help shape the future of AI-driven healthcare delivery.

Job Responsibilities:

· Develop and maintain clinical content, including treatment pathways, order sets, and documentation templates for various medical specialties.
· Analyze clinical workflows to identify areas for improvement and implement data-driven, AI-enhanced solutions to boost efficiency and patient care.
· Collaborate with clinicians, healthcare providers, and other stakeholders to ensure clinical content is evidence-based, up-to-date, and aligned with the latest medical guidelines.
· Work closely with the EMR and AI development teams to seamlessly integrate clinical content and intelligent workflows into the software ecosystem.
· Participate in user acceptance testing to ensure clinical content and workflows function as intended within the EMR and AI modules.
· Provide training and support to clinicians and other end-users on effectively utilizing the clinical content and intelligent workflows within the EMR.
· Collaborate with top-tier healthcare professionals and our agile tech team to continuously enhance clinical modules.
· Drive measurable improvements in patient care, decision support, and clinical efficiency through innovative digital health and AI initiatives.

Qualifications:

· MBBS degree from a HEC Recognized University.

· Familiarity with EMR systems, clinical workflows, and healthcare informatics.
· Knowledge of medical terminologies and coding systems (e.g., ICD-10, CPT, SNOMED CT).
· Experience in clinical research, data analysis, and content development.

· Strong understanding of evidence-based medicine and clinical practice guidelines.

·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ills.

· Strong communication and interpersonal skills to effectively collaborate with cross-functional teams.

· Detail-oriented with a commitment to accuracy and quality.

·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and meet tight deadlines.
· Minimum of 2-3 years of experience in a similar role, preferably in an EMR or healthcare technology setting.
. Familiarity with US Healthcare system is preferred.
